California·Code BPC Business and Professions Code - BPC·Div. 3. DIVISION 3. PROFESSIONS AND VOCATIONS GENERALLY·Ch. 3.9. CHAPTER 3.9. Interior Designers
(a)The council may issue a certification to any applicant who provides satisfactory evidence that they meet all of the requirements of this chapter and who complies with the bylaws, rules, and procedures established by the council.
(1)In order to obtain a certification, an applicant shall submit an application as provided by the council and provide the council with satisfactory evidence that they meet all of the following requirements:
(A)Passage of an interior design examination approved by the council.
(B)Any of the following education and experience pathways:
(i)The person is a graduate of a four- or five-year accredited interior design degree program, and has two years of diversified interior design experience.
